Can a steam oven be used as a regular oven?

Yes, a steam oven can be used as a regular oven. Steam ovens are typically built in and have the same features as a traditional oven, such as temperature settings and different heating functions. However, they add the additional feature of being able to generate steam during the cooking process.

This additional feature is beneficial because it helps with meals such as vegetables and meats, adding additional flavor and moistness. Additionally, because steam is added during the cooking process, it can help speed up cooking times, because the steam helps heat the food faster than just convection or dry heat.

So whether you use all the features of the steam oven or just use it as a normal oven, it is possible to use a steam oven as a regular oven.

Do steam ovens make things crispy?

Yes, steam ovens can make things crispy. Steam ovens utilize a combination of dry heat and steam to create a unique cooking environment that can mimic a traditional oven, deep fryer, slow cooker, and more.

The steam helps to retain moisture in the food while the dry heat will crisp up the outside. Depending on the dish, you may need to reduce the humidity or increase the temperature to achieve a crispier outcome.

Additionally, items such as pizza and french fries may require a preheat setting and the use of a crisper tray. With the combination of steam and dry heat, a steam oven can produce a variety of excellent dishes with a crispy exterior.

Can you leave oven racks in during Steam Clean?

Yes, you can leave oven racks in during a Steam Clean cycle. The heat and the steam generated by the Steam Clean cycle should be sufficient to thoroughly clean the racks and other parts of the oven. Make sure that the oven racks are properly placed so that all surfaces are exposed to the steam.

This will ensure a thorough clean. Also, be aware that some surfaces of the racks might discolor after the steam cleaning cycle. However, this discoloration should not affect the performance of the racks in any way.

Is it better to steam or bake a cake?

It really depends on the recipe and desired outcome. Generally, cakes that are denser or are more pudding-like when baked are best steamed, as steam adds moisture to the cake. Steaming is also ideal for cakes that are meant to be sticky, such as some sponge cakes and muffins.

On the other hand, baking is a great option for cakes with a light texture. Baked cakes often have a more delicate texture and a beautiful “crust” on their exterior. Baking is also great for cakes that have select ingredients, such as oil, that will not mix when steamed.

To be safe, you should always follow the instructions on the recipe and make sure to check the cake with a toothpick to check the doneness.

Why is there water at bottom of my steam oven?

The water at the bottom of your steam oven is likely there for a number of reasons. One possibility is that it is condensation from the steam created during the cooking process. If there is not a good seal on the oven door, steam can escape and condense on the walls and bottom of the oven, forming droplets of water.

Additionally, if you are cooking with a lot of liquid ingredients, some of that liquid can also escape, forming a puddle at the bottom of the oven. Finally, if you are using a steam oven cleaner or descaler, the instructions may call for adding water after the cleaner has been applied, which could also form a puddle.

Regardless of the source, water at the bottom of your oven should be wiped up and cleaned off after each use to prevent any moisture buildup which could lead to rust or other damage.
